The recent patch to support Power IEEE128 causes a bootstrap failure on AIX and possibly all non-GLIBC systems.
+#if defined(__powerpc64__) && __BYTE_ORDER__ == __ORDER_LITTLE_ENDIAN__ \ + && defined __GLIBC_PREREQ && __GLIBC_PREREQ (2, 32) +#define POWER_IEEE128 1 +#endif __GLIBC_PREREQ is tested on all systems. /nasfarm/edelsohn/src/src/libgfortran/libgfortran.h:107:49: error: missing binary operator before token "(" 107 | && defined __GLIBC_PREREQ && __GLIBC_PREREQ (2, 32) | ^
